Description
Foundations of Computer Science by Behrouz Forouzan is a comprehensive introduction to the fundamental concepts of computer science. It provides a structured and clear approach to understanding how computers and algorithms work.
Computer science is the backbone of modern technology. This book covers essential topics, including algorithms, data structures, programming languages, and computational theory. It builds a strong foundation for students entering the field.
A step-by-step approach ensures clarity. The book starts with basic principles like binary systems and logic gates before progressing to advanced topics such as complexity analysis and artificial intelligence. It balances theory with practical applications.
Problem-solving is a key focus. The book teaches readers how to design efficient algorithms and analyze computational problems. Each chapter includes exercises, case studies, and real-world examples to reinforce learning.
Programming concepts are introduced in an accessible way. While language-independent, the book provides examples using widely used programming languages. This approach helps students grasp core computer science principles before specializing.
The latest edition includes emerging topics. Readers learn about cybersecurity, machine learning, and cloud computing, gaining insight into modern advancements in the field. It prepares students for real-world challenges in computing.
Logical thinking and critical analysis are emphasized. The book teaches students how to approach problems systematically and develop innovative solutions. It lays the groundwork for further studies in software development, networking, and database management.
For students, educators, and aspiring programmers, this book is an essential resource. It provides a deep understanding of computer science fundamentals, ensuring success in both academic and professional settings. With its structured content and engaging explanations, it remains a trusted guide for mastering the foundations of computing.
Reviews
There are no reviews yet.